In the game “Connections” by The New York Times, you’re presented with 16 unique terms that need to be organized into four hidden groups. Try grouping four words or phrases that seem related, and if accurate, they’ll be categorized based on their common theme or link. Each category has a different color difficulty level, starting with the easiest (Yellow), followed by Green, Blue, and the most challenging (Purple). The categories can span various topics such as late-night snacks, chocolate brands, Bible books, or words that sound like animal noises. You have only four attempts to guess correctly; otherwise, you lose your progress and the categories are unveiled.
